Q: I got married last year. My periods were irregular from the beginning and my last but one cycle came after 1 month 20 days. After that I didn't get periods. I have tested myself at home for pregnancy which was negative. As I was suffering from severe stomach pain on the left side, I consulted the doctor and underwent ultrasonic pelvic test which showed polycystic ovaries. I am taking Ayurvedic medicine for that and the doctor has warned me that because of the medicines I may have conceived. After taking medicines for 10 days I didn't get periods. So I took a pregnancy test which was positive. As we have some personal problems we are not planning a kid now. So I am planning to get an abortion. My Question is will be there be any problem in future in conceiving?

A:People with polycystic ovaries do have irregular periods. So sometimes one can get pregnant without knowing. What kind of contraception were you on when you got pregnant?Generally, abortion done in a medical/sterile environment does not result in infertility. PCOS (Polycystic ovarian syndrome)does cause some problems with getting pregnant. I would urge you to get on some effective contraceptive if you do not want to get pregnant again after the therapeutic abortion. It is not a good idea to use abortion as a contraceptive device. Fortunately, there are many safe and effective contraceptive options available these days.
